Ill add my experience as well. I work at an AQ and our reef is lit with 3 AI hydras. I don't like them, but it wasnt my decision to go with them. Well, we spent nearly $2,000 on them, and after less than 2 years, two out of the 3 power supplies failed. I talked to customer support, and told them I am baffled that we are having problems with our two year old, $2,000 lights, and could they please make the situation right. Mind you, At the same time, i had a cheapo $80.00 ebay led fixture that was out lasting and out performing these hydras over my 30 gallon reef on my desk. Well, customer service did nothing, except tell us we had to spend an additional 100.00 on new power supplies. So to conclude, i am unhappy with the hydras, and honestly led's overall. This reef used to have 14k metal halides, and it looked much better than the hydras. In the future, i am going with T5's, which I love. People will argue about energy cost etc if you dont use leds, but end of story is that T5s are cheaper (bulbs dont cost much) and they are reliable. I will say that the LED business model leaves a lot to be desired right now. It seems that making previous lights obsolete and constantly coming out with something better is the way companies are going. Though Kessil doesn't seem to be doing that just yet. The A360we came out almost five years ago? And it's still sold today. They came out with the ap700 but that doesn't replace the A360we but just provides another option that has built in wifi.

But yea I haven't used halides or T5 in ten years until recently. And that technology hasn't changed since I stopped using them. It was like riding a bike and it all came back to me pretty quick. For me that's pretty appealing. I dont want my lights to be obsolete every 2 years, constantly chasing the next upgrade. Other than kessil the other manufacturers can't seem to replace models fast enough.
